Job Description Job Description: We are currently hiring adjunct faculty to teach PHYS 123 –Science of Flight at our Fort Lauderdale campus. Course Description: Connects basic principles within select branches of the natural sciences - atmospheric science, biology, chemistry, environmental science, and physics - with general applications of flight. Aerodynamics and aircraft control; propulsion and hydraulics; aircraft materials; effects of atmospheric phenomenon; environmental impacts. Qualifications Applicant Qualifications Doctor’s or Master’s degree in teaching discipline, or a Masters’s degree with a concentration in teaching discipline (minimum of 18 graduate semester hours in the teaching discipline). Degrees Within the Teaching Discipline: Aeronautics, Astrophysics, Atmospheric Physics, Atmospheric Science, Meteorology, Physics, Science Education. Related Discipline: Engineering, Earth Sciences, Environmental Sciences, Geophysical Sciences, Natural Sciences.
